S676 ASC is a 1998 Volvo S70 in White with a 1,984c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 1998 Volvo S70 models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.7% with a typical mileage of 112,832 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volvo S70 fails its MOT is constant velocity joint gaiter split, accounting for 3,223 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S676 ASC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volvo S70 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 28 years old, this Volvo S70 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
